Implement git_merge_base()
It's implemented in revwalk.c so it has access to the revision walker's commit cache and related functions. The algorithm is the one used by git, modified so it fits better with the library's functions.

@@ -244,6 +264,144 @@ static int commit_parse(git_revwalk *walk, commit_object *commit)
return error == GIT_SUCCESS ? GIT_SUCCESS : git__rethrow(error, "Failed to parse commit");
}
+static commit_object *interesting(commit_list *list)
+{
+ while (list) {
+ commit_object *commit = list->item;
+ list = list->next;
+ if (commit->flags & STALE)
+ continue;
+
+ return commit;
+ }
+
+ return NULL;
+}
+
+static int merge_bases_many(commit_list **out, git_revwalk *walk, commit_object *one, git_vector *twos)
+{
+ int error;
+ unsigned int i;
+ commit_object *two;
+ commit_list *list = NULL, *result = NULL;
+
+ /* if the commit is repeated, we have a our merge base already */
+ git_vector_foreach(twos, i, two) {
+ if (one == two)
+ return commit_list_insert(one, out) ? GIT_SUCCESS : GIT_ENOMEM;
+ }
+
+ if ((error = commit_parse(walk, one)) < GIT_SUCCESS)
+ return error;
+
+ one->flags |= PARENT1;
+ if (commit_list_insert(one, &list) == NULL)
+ return GIT_ENOMEM;
+
+ git_vector_foreach(twos, i, two) {
+ commit_parse(walk, two);
+ two->flags |= PARENT2;
+ if (commit_list_insert_by_date(two, &list) == NULL)
+ return GIT_ENOMEM;
+ }
+
+ /* as long as there are non-STALE commits */
+ while (interesting(list)) {
+ commit_object *commit = list->item;
+ commit_list *next;
+ int flags;
+
+ next = list->next;
+ git__free(list);
+ list = next;
+
+ flags = commit->flags & (PARENT1 | PARENT2 | STALE);
+ if (flags == (PARENT1 | PARENT2)) {
+ if (!(commit->flags & RESULT)) {
+ commit->flags |= RESULT;
+ if (commit_list_insert_by_date(commit, &result) == NULL)
+ return GIT_ENOMEM;
+ }
+ /* we mark the parents of a merge stale */
+ flags |= STALE;
+ }
+
+ for (i = 0; i < commit->out_degree; i++) {
+ commit_object *p = commit->parents[i];
+ if ((p->flags & flags) == flags)
+ continue;
+
+ if ((error = commit_parse(walk, p)) < GIT_SUCCESS)
+ return error;
+
+ p->flags |= flags;
+ if (commit_list_insert_by_date(p, &list) == NULL)
+ return GIT_ENOMEM;
+ }
+ }
+
+ commit_list_free(&list);
+ /* filter out any stale commits in the results */
+ list = result;
+ result = NULL;
+
+ while (list) {
+ struct commit_list *next = list->next;
+ if (!(list->item->flags & STALE))
+ if (commit_list_insert_by_date(list->item, &result) == NULL)
+ return GIT_ENOMEM;
+
+ free(list);
+ list = next;
+ }
+
+ *out = result;
+ return GIT_SUCCESS;
+}
+
+int git_merge_base(git_oid *out, git_repository *repo, git_oid *one, git_oid *two)
+{
+ git_revwalk *walk;
+ git_vector list;
+ commit_list *result;
+ commit_object *commit;
+ void *contents[1];
+ int error;
+
+ error = git_revwalk_new(&walk, repo);
+ if (error < GIT_SUCCESS)
+ return error;
+
+ commit = commit_lookup(walk, two);
+ if (commit == NULL)
+ goto cleanup;
+
+ /* This is just one value, so we can do it on the stack */
+ memset(&list, 0x0, sizeof(git_vector));
+ contents[0] = commit;
+ list.length = 1;
+ list.contents = contents;
+
+ commit = commit_lookup(walk, one);
+ if (commit == NULL)
+ goto cleanup;
+
+ error = merge_bases_many(&result, walk, commit, &list);
+ if (error < GIT_SUCCESS)
+ return error;
+
+ if (result == NULL)
+ return GIT_ENOTFOUND;
+
+ git_oid_cpy(out, &result->item->oid);
+ commit_list_free(&result);
+
+cleanup:
+ git_revwalk_free(walk);
+
+ return GIT_SUCCESS;
+}
